WebGo to the Office Admin center -> Users -> Active users -> select a user (with mailbox) -> Mail tab -> Manage email apps and uncheck the basic authentication protocols: POP, IMAP, SMTP. See figure 4. Note that SMTP, MAPI over HTTP, and Mobile (Exchange ActiveSync) support both basic and modern authentication. Figure 4. fidelity vs morgan stanley reddit
